(MENAFN- Ameliorate Digital Consultancy) The gear measuring machines market is anticipated to reach US$ 499.7 million by the end of 2032, after surpassing a worth of US$ 369.3 million in 2022 at a CAGR of 3.1%. By the end of 2022, sales of gear measuring machines in the automotive industry were more than 25% of the global measuring machines market.

The Crucial Role of Gears

Gears are the unsung heroes of machinery. They transmit power and motion, enabling everything from the smooth operation of your car to the precision of advanced manufacturing equipment. The efficiency of gears depends on their geometry and surface quality, making precise measurements crucial.

Precision at the Core

Gear measuring machines are engineered with precision at their core. They are designed to measure variparameters of gears, including tooth profile, pitch, runout, and concentricity, with exceptional accuracy. These measurements are essential for ensuring that gears mesh seamlessly and transmit power without noise or vibrations.

Quality Assurance in Manufacturing

In industries where gears are employed, such as automotive, aerospace, and industrial machinery, the margin for error is virtually nonexistent. A minor deviation in gear geometry can lead to significant performance issues and costly downtime. Gear measuring machines act as gatekeepers, rigorously inspecting gears during the manufacturing process to detect even the slightest imperfections.

Advancements in Technology

The Gear Measuring Machines Market has witnessed remarkable advancements in recent years. These machines now incorporate cutting-edge technology, including high-resolution optical systems, advanced software algorithms, and CNC (computer numerical control) capabilities. These features enable them to provide highly accurate measurements, often in a matter of seconds, enhancing the overall efficiency of the manufacturing process.

Streamlined Production Processes

Gear measuring machines not only ensure the quality of individual gears but also streamline production processes. With automation and software integration, these machines can perform measurements swiftly and efficiently. This reduces the need for manual inspections, minimizes human error, and accelerates the production cycle.

Competitive Landscape

In the global gear measuring machines industry, major players such as KAPP Werkzeugmaschinen, Gleason Corporation, KLINGELNBERG, GmbH., Osaka Seimitsu Kikai Co., Wenzel America Ltd., Tokyo Technical Instrument, Inc., and others are strategically steering their endeavors towards acquiring substantial market share. They are achieving this by introducing cutting-edge, technologically advanced products, tfortifying their foothold in this dynamic sector.
